# --- BloomGate env file ---
# Welcome aboard! BloomGate is the bloom filter we run in front of
# the Pondstore key-value cluster so we don't hammer it with lookups
# for keys that don't exist. Tuning knobs (filter size, hash count,
# rebuild interval) live further down — sane defaults, don't panic.
# One thing you do need: the credential for the filter sync channel.
# It goes on the very next line:

sealed setting: ARCHIVE_KEY3=8d0

Subject: Release — formula sandbox v2

New folks: user-supplied formulas in Tallygrove now run inside the Hushcell sandbox. No filesystem, no network, 50ms CPU cap. Anything outside the allowlisted function set throws a SandboxViolation — do not add functions without a security sign-off. Docs are on the team wiki. Build token for this release is below.

trace token, kahog-tajeg: htk6_97d963

The garage occupancy feed for the Brindlewood campus arrives over a message queue every thirty seconds, one record per level, published by the Stallgrid edge boxes. Counts can briefly go negative when a sensor double-fires on exit; the ingest job clamps these to zero and flags the interval. If the feed stalls for more than five minutes, the dashboard falls back to the last known snapshot. Sensor mappings, queue names, and the replay procedure are documented on the internal page below.

runbook for tahog-kadug: https://gitlab.qirvanworks.corp/projects/pages/view/b139298aed28

## 5.2.0 — New relevance defaults

Heads up, reviewer: we've finally landed the relevance tuning notes from the Quillfish search overhaul as actual defaults. Title matches now outweigh body matches by a wider margin, recency decay kicks in at 30 days instead of 90, and the synonym expander is on by default. Old indexes keep their per-index overrides, so nothing should shift for existing tenants until reindex. Fresh indexes pick up everything automatically. The ranker now initializes with the default values listed below.

settings of fafog-haduf:
ZORIX_PIN=4648
ZORIX_METRICS_HOST=metrics.zorix.paliqsys.corp
ZORIX_LOG_LEVEL=info
ZORIX_TENANT=druix